Timeline
The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.
- 2020-01-28 First read in Senate and referred to Senate Health and Human Services S.J. 98
introduction, reading-1, referral-committee - 2020-02-05 Scheduled for hearing
- 2020-02-07 Scheduled for hearing
- 2020-02-12 Scheduled for hearing
- 2020-02-12 Health and Human Services Motion to amend, Passed Amendment 81A
amendment-introduction, amendment-passage - 2020-02-12 Health and Human Services Do Pass Amended, Passed, YEAS 6, NAYS 0.
committee-passage - 2020-02-12 Certified uncontested, placed on consent
- 2020-02-18 Senate Do Pass Amended, Passed, YEAS 34, NAYS 0. S.J. 239
passage - 2020-02-19 First Reading House H.J. 315
- 2020-02-27 Referred to House Health and Human Services H.J. 433
referral-committee - 2020-03-05 Scheduled for hearing
- 2020-03-05 Health and Human Services Do Pass, Passed, YEAS 9, NAYS 0.
committee-passage - 2020-03-05 Certified uncontested, placed on consent
- 2020-03-09 House of Representatives Do Pass Amended, Passed, YEAS 66, NAYS 0. H.J. 508
passage - 2020-03-10 Signed by the President S.J. 475
- 2020-03-11 Signed by the Speaker H.J. 583
- 2020-03-12 Delivered to the Governor on March 12, 2020 S.J. 522
executive-receipt - 2020-03-30 Signed by the Governor on March 23, 2020 S.J. 558
